| Subject: [PATCH] BACKPORT: FROMLIST: mm: multigenerational lru: eviction |
| |
| The eviction consumes old generations. Given an lruvec, the eviction |
| scans the pages on the per-zone lists indexed by either of min_seq[2]. |
| It first tries to select a type based on the values of min_seq[2]. |
| When anon and file types are both available from the same generation, |
| it selects the one that has a lower refault rate. |
| |
| During a scan, the eviction sorts pages according to their new |
| generation numbers, if the aging has found them referenced. It also |
| moves pages from the tiers that have higher refault rates than tier 0 |
| to the next generation. When it finds all the per-zone lists of a |
| selected type are empty, the eviction increments min_seq[2] indexed by |
| this selected type. |
| |
| With the aging and the eviction in place, we can build page reclaim in |
| a straightforward manner: |
| 1) In order to reduce the latency, direct reclaim only invokes the |
| aging when both min_seq[2] reaches max_seq-1; otherwise it invokes |
| the eviction. |
| 2) In order to avoid the aging in the direct reclaim path, kswapd |
| does the background aging. It invokes the aging when either of |
| min_seq[2] reaches max_seq-1; otherwise it invokes the eviction. |
